RI-INBRE is based out of the University of Rhode Island and is housed at the College of Pharmacy. The network has the objective to support and develop talented individuals, committed to research careers in Rhode Island, and to build the biomedical research capacity of Rhode Island institutions. The six participating research institutions are shown below. The research foci of the RI-INBRE are: molecular toxicology, cell biology, and behavioral science.
